<title>Guv Hopeful McKenna Urges Budget Cuts, Spending Freeze</title>
<link>http://www.mckennagov.com/site/apps/nlnet/content2.aspx?c=swL1KeNZLvH&amp;b=5560631&amp;ct=7776713</link>
<description>December 8, 2009, Chicago Business&lt;p&gt;&quot;... start by rolling back spending to the 2006 level &#8212; anaction that would require nearly a 20% cut of about $5 billion. Thenhe'd hold spending at that level at least until 2012 or 2013 &#8212; &quot;untilrevenues have grown enough for us to pay down some of the state's debt,unpaid bills and unfunded pension liabilities.&quot; &lt;br /&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description>

<title>McKenna: Fix State Budget Without Tax Hike</title>
<link>http://www.mckennagov.com/site/apps/nlnet/content2.aspx?c=swL1KeNZLvH&amp;b=5560631&amp;ct=7772285</link>
<description>&lt;em&gt;Associated Press&lt;/em&gt;, December 8, 2009&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Republican candidate for Illinois governor Andy McKenna says he has aplan to rescue the state's finances without an income tax increase. McKenna said Tuesday that the state needs to return to 2006 spending levels. His running mate for lieutenant governor, state Sen. Matt Murphy, saysthat will mean &quot;short-term pain&quot; until the state's finances can turnaround.&lt;br /&gt;</description>
